    I went in during lunch and the place was empty. This is a conveyor belt style restaurant where you can choose the sushi you want as it goes by, then you are billed by the color of the plate. The plate color prices are clearly marked on the wall. They also have a menu that you can order from. I ordered the lunch Beef Bento box and grabbed some sushi from the belt. The place is tidy and well laid out. The server was very friendly and attentive. The sushi was as just fair though. So on the food I have to only give it 3 stars. There are so many really good sushi places in the area.

    The location was perfect with plenty of parking. The staff was very courteous. The conveyor belt for the food choices was fun and exciting. Lots of choices for great sushi options. If you order from the kiosk at the table, the items are delivered by an express belt. You sit in a booth so you are pretty self-contained. The plates are priced by color codes so no surprises when the bill arrives. Try everything at least once because all the dishes were delicious. I believe they have a happy hour on certain days with half off on sushi. A really great and fun date night location.
